At its lowest setting, a centrifuge rotates with an angular speed of ω1 = 250 rad/s. When it is switched to the next higher setting it takes t = 7.5 s to uniformly accelerate to its final angular speed ω2 = 550 rad/s. a. Calculate the angular acceleration of the centrifuge α1 in rad/s2 over the time interval t. b. Calculate the total angular displacement (in radians) of the centrifuge, Δθ, as it accelerates from the initial to the final speed.
